2013-07-28 14 views
1

我們有一個系統負責推送iOS,Android和Windows手機的移動通知。我們沒有爲每個平臺帳戶(因爲我們有很少的應用程序)。到目前爲止,我們已經能夠使用少量的設備測試我們系統的這一部分,因此只有少量的消息,但我們需要能夠用大量的數字來測試我們的服務。因此,舉例來說,我們的系統對電子郵件也是如此,因此我們使用Google的「+」功能來測試我們能夠在幾分鐘內發送數以萬計的電子郵件,但我們如何通過移動推送來實現這一點?測試大量移動推送通知的方式

TIA

回答

0

對於谷歌雲端通訊,您可以使用dry_run參數,它允許您發送許多請求到GCM服務器,而無需actaully將消息發送到設備:

dry_run如果包括在內,允許開發人員在不實際發送消息的情況下測試其請求可選的。默認值爲false,並且必須是JSON布爾值。

據我所知Apple推送通知沒有類似的機制。您可以編寫一個模擬APN服務器的進程。它必須接受傳入的客戶端套接字,並且能夠讀取客戶端發送的通知二進制數據(可能驗證傳入數據的正確性)。

你可以用Microsift推送通知做類似的事情。